More of Colin the Cuckoo

More of Colin the Cuckoo

May 14, 2018December 23, 2019 Brian Anderson Leave a comment

5000 miles from the UK to Central Africa and he’s done it for the last three years at least that’s 30,000 miles on his migration route. They reckon he makes the 3000km crossing of the mediterranean / Sahara in one flight. Now that makes my 75 mile drive to see him seem well worth it. […]

Mongolia – 11th May (Day 4) – Travel from Ullanbataar to Dalanzadgad

Mongolia – 11th May (Day 4) – Travel from Ullanbataar to Dalanzadgad

June 14, 2017December 23, 2019 Simon Colenutt Leave a comment

Today was mainly a driving day 570km south from Ulaanbaatar to Dalanzadgad passing through the Gobi Desert with a few stops, mainly at lakes, en-route. The landscape was vast, stark and barren, mainly flat with a few rocky outcrops and dominated by gravel plains with sparse grass. The common birds here were Horned Lark, Asian […]
